PALMERSTON NORTH HAS VOTED AGAINST CREATING SEPARATE MĀORI WARDS Palmerston North people have spoken and more than two-thirds who voted were in opposition to creating separate Māori wards. Results from a binding poll came in on Saturday night, with 14,567 voting against wards for the city council and 6530 voting for. The percentage was 68.87 against and 30.88 per cent for. The turnout was at 37.21 per cent of eligible voters, and 49 votes were counted as blank and four "informal" votes received.
